Each of five questions on a multiple-choice examination has four choices, only one of which is correct. The student is attempting to guess the answers. The random variable X is the number of questions answer correctly. Probability that the student will get Atmost three correct answers

Assume that experimental measurements for a certain organism have shown that cells can convert two-thirds (wt/wt) of the substrate carbon to biomass carbon. Calculate the stoichiometric coefficients for the following biological reactions:
Hexadecane: C16H34 + aO2 + bNH3
c(C4.4H7.3N0.86O1.2) + dH2O + eCO2

Calculate RQ value based on the analysis of the inlet air and the exhaust gas as follows. —Inlet Air: 02, 20.90%; CO2, 0.01% — Outlet Gas: 02, 18.30%; CO2, 2.90%
